Hampi is located on the Deccan plateau, which is one of the oldest and most stable geographical formations in the world. The plateau comprises rocks dated to be about 2.5 billion years old. Geologically, these rocks are termed as ‘Younger Granites’ and are spread over a 500 km long and 20 km wide belt running north-south. The granitic rocks in the area were formed towards the end of the Archean Era of the geological time scale, due to magmatic action leading to the melting of the older gneissic rocks and intrusion. The thickness of this younger granitic complex varies from 5 to 25 km.
